D. SAUNDERS and L. Brittain of Cambridge University debating team, pit oratorical abilities against Mercyhurst's K. Lynch and M. Fiedler. Cultural Program To encourage a taste for the intellectual and aesthetic, Mercyhurst included in her cultural program a representative group of artists and lecturers, as Well as contributions from the Mercy- hurst Drama and Fine Arts departments. Among student-centered activities was That Name of Delight, directed by Sara Lee Stadel- man, which demonstrated that speech and the dance should simultaneously express a dramatic moment. Other student productions, Wisteria Trees, one-act student-directed plays, and the musical comedy, Plain and Fancyf gave drama and music enthusiasts the opportunity to display their talents. Then, too, Mercyhurst debaters en- joyed their lively discussion with visiting Cam- bridge University debaters, and Dr. Donatellils St. Thomas Day program proved philosophically enriching. T. CARNEY, vice-president of the Eli Lilly Co., emphasizes the necessity of Educating for Inequalityf' , i 4 1 1 l ii, Q DOROTHY DAY, editor of Q 'Q the Catholic Worker, stresses the necessity of Christian char- ity in today's world. FATHER HENRY Birken- hauer, S. J. parallels Mary and the modern woman at the So- dality Communion Breakfast, December 8. 80

K LYNCH, Irish colleen, displays a Bit of the Killarney to add to the St. Paddy's Day celebration. Campus ucens Queenships are an important feature of all campus life. Various classes have been privi- leged to represent Mercyhurst on campus and off. At the annual Sweethearts Ball, Sandi Vali- centi, a junior,was crowned sweetheart of Gan- non's AEfIf Fraternity. This is the third straight year a Mercyhurst girl was selected for the honor. The military from two colleges chose Mercy- hurst girls to be their Queens. Pat Sullivan, a senior, reigned over the Saint Bonaventure Mili- tary Ball and Brenda Scutella was elected Co-Ed Colonel of the Pershing Riiie Honorary Mili- tary Fraternity at Gannon College. Heidi Martin, junior, was chosen by the stu- dent body to represent Mercyhurst in the Cam- pus Cover Girl contest sponsored by the Pitts- burgh Press. In December, Carol Fuller, sophomore, repre- sented the college in the annual Gannon Winter Carnival and presented- a radiant picture against a snowflake background. QUEENS MAY reign at dances, but each girl is a sovereign to her date.
